
Senior Data Engineer
Prosum, Agoura Hills, CA, United States
We’re looking for a
Senior Data Engineer
to join our Integrations team and play a critical role in building scalable, reliable data solutions that power core business operations.
If you enjoy owning data architecture, solving complex integration challenges, and working across a modern cloud ecosystem—this role is for you.
What You’ll Do
As a key member of the team, you will:
Design & Build Data Solutions
Architect scalable, maintainable data pipelines and integrations
Translate business needs into technical designs and system architectures
Deliver robust ETL/ELT solutions using modern platforms
Build fault-tolerant pipelines for structured and unstructured data
Support both real-time and batch processing
Optimize performance across SQL and data platforms
Develop integrations using REST, SOAP, and messaging systems (Kafka, RabbitMQ)
Work with tools like Azure Data Factory, Azure SQL, SSIS, and iPaaS platforms
Operational Excellence
Ensure high availability, observability, and reliability
Troubleshoot and resolve complex data issues
Partner with BI teams, analysts, and business stakeholders
Mentor junior engineers and guide best practices
Lead POCs and drive continuous improvement
Implement CI/CD pipelines and version control
Build automation using Python and PowerShell
Ensure strong data governance, security, and compliance practices
What You Bring
5+ years of hands‑on experience with:
SSIS or similar ETL tools
Strong SQL skills (queries, stored procedures, performance tuning)
Experience designing scalable data architectures and integrations
Proficiency in Python and/or PowerShell
Strong troubleshooting and problem‑solving abilities
Experience supporting enterprise data pipelines in production environments
Bachelor’s degree in a related field (Computer Science, Data, etc.)
Nice to Have
Experience with Databricks, Snowflake, Synapse, BigQuery, or similar platforms
Familiarity with iPaaS tools (SnapLogic, TIBCO, etc.)
Knowledge of Azure services (Data Lake, Functions, Logic Apps, Blob Storage)
Experience building frameworks for monitoring, logging, and data quality
Prior experience mentoring engineers or contributing to technical strategy
Relevant cloud certifications (Azure preferred)
